proletarize

pro·le·tar·ize

[proh-li-tair-ahyz]
verb (used with object), pro·le·tar·ized, pro·le·tar·iz·ing.
to proletarianize.
Also, especially British, pro·le·tar·ise.

pro·le·tar·i·za·tion, noun
